These singles reached the top of US Billboard magazine's charts in 1954.
| First week | Number of weeks | Title | Artist | Label |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| January 2, 1954 | 8 | "Oh My Papa" | Eddie Fisher | RCA Victor |
| February 27, 1954 | 2 | "Secret Love" | Doris Day | Columbia |
| March 13, 1954 | 1 | "Make Love To Me" | Jo Stafford | Columbia |
| March 20, 1954 | 1 | "Secret Love" | Doris Day | Columbia |
| March 27, 1954 | 2 | "Make Love To Me" | Jo Stafford | Columbia |
| April 10, 1954 | 7 | "Wanted" | Perry Como | RCA Victor |
| May 29, 1954 | 10 | "Little Things Mean a Lot" | Kitty Kallen | Decca |
| August 7, 1954 | 7 | "Sh-Boom" | Crew-Cuts | Mercury |
| September 25, 1954 | 6 | "Hey There" | Rosemary Clooney | Cactus |
| November 6, 1954 | 1 | "This Ole House" | Rosemary Clooney | Columbia |
| November 13, 1954 | 3 | "I Need You Now" | Eddie Fisher | RCA Victor |
| December 4, 1954 | 7 | "Mr. Sandman" | The Chordettes | Bluebird |
